Output 26c77b53aa544d9305bb3d9982a0889f6f427ecd44396cbf1cc817acba738983:4

value
757990
script pubkey
OP_0 OP_PUSHBYTES_20 02b832663d07fcae5977adedb505d7b258f132b4
address
bc1qq2urye3aql72ukth4hkm2pwhkfv0zv45j64dg6
transaction
26c77b53aa544d9305bb3d9982a0889f6f427ecd44396cbf1cc817acba738983
spent
true